A leading recruitment agency is seeking a Forklift Driver in Droitwich, UK. You will ensure production machines are supplied with materials and maintain high standards of housekeeping. Candidates must have a valid FLT Licence and prior experience.
This role offers excellent earning potential, weekly pay, and benefits such as a pension scheme, paid holidays, and development opportunities. Enjoy a clean and supportive work environment with great welfare and development initiatives.

How to prepare for a job interview at Assist Resourcing UK Ltd
✨Know Your Forklift Basics
Make sure you brush up on your forklift knowledge before the interview. Be ready to discuss your experience with different types of forklifts and any specific safety protocols you've followed. This shows that you're not just qualified, but also serious about safety.
✨Highlight Your Housekeeping Skills
Since maintaining high standards of housekeeping is key in this role, prepare examples of how you've kept your work area tidy and organised in previous jobs. This will demonstrate your attention to detail and commitment to a clean work environment.
✨Show Enthusiasm for Development Opportunities
The job offers great development initiatives, so express your eagerness to learn and grow within the company. Share any past experiences where you took the initiative to improve your skills or take on new responsibilities.
✨Prepare Questions About the Role
Have a few thoughtful questions ready to ask at the end of the interview. Inquire about the team you'll be working with or the specific materials you'll be handling. This shows that you're genuinely interested in the position and want to ensure it's a good fit for both you and the company.
